If the smoke alarm device with radio link
makes a direct or indirect contact with
the device with activated master functi-
on and therefore has a radio connection
with at least one of the remaining smoke
alarm devices with radio links for crea-
ting the radio group, it is confirmed with
a green radio LED light.
After this green confirmation, the radio
LED changes to a regular, long, yellow in-
terval which shows that the connection
mode is (also) activated for this device

now and the device is ready to connect
to other smoke alarm devices with radio
links to form a radio group.
You can now continue with further ins-
tallation out of the radio group.
The remaining time span for the more
structuring of the radio group extends
with each new device as soon as it is in-
cluded in the radio group with activated
connection mode and by 10 minutes for
all devices already in the radio group and
with connection mode activated.
To add more smoke alarm devices with
radio links to the radio group, repeat the
procedure given in this section. Up to 15
smoke alarm devices with radio links can
be connected to one radio group.
If a smoke alarm device with radio link
shows a red signal when it is activated in
the planned installation position when
connected to the short yellow interval
of the radio LED, the planned installa-
tion position for this device is outside
of the radio range which enables it to
be connected to the device in the ra-
dio group.
This means that there is no other smoke
alarm device with radio link in the ran-
ge, which, directly or indirectly, enables
via signal forwarding (routing-repeating
function) an access to the device acti-
vated with the master function or you
have overshot the connection mode
time span available for creating the ra-
dio group.
If the radio LED shows a red signal,
check whether the other smoke alarm
devices with radio links of the group
are (still) in connection mode displayed
constantly with a regular, long, yellow
interval of the radio LED. If this is not
the case, please follow the instruction in
section Expanding radio group/activating
connection mode and „Repeat connec-
tion attempt".
